What Is the Food and Wine Festival 2026 EPCOT?

The food and wine festival 2026 epcot is an annual culinary celebration held at EPCOT in Walt Disney World Resort. The event fills the park with Global Marketplaces that serve small dishes and drinks inspired by cultures around the world.

The 2026 festival is particularly important because it marks 30 years of the EPCOT International Food & Wine Festival. Disney has brought back or reimagined 30 dishes from earlier festivals to celebrate this milestone.

EPCOT Food and Wine Festival 2026 Dates

The festival officially opened on August 27, 2026, and continues through November 21, 2026. That gives visitors nearly three months to explore its special menus and entertainment. Not every experience operates for the entire festival period. Some marketplaces and seasonal activities start later, so guests should check the schedule before choosing a visit date.

Global Marketplaces and International Food

Food is the main attraction at the food and wine festival 2026 epcot celebration. More than 30 Global Marketplaces and other participating locations offer flavors inspired by countries across six continents. Guests can move around EPCOT and order small portions instead of sitting down for one large meal. This format makes it easier to sample food from several countries during the same visit.

Popular destinations and themes include Australia, Belgium, Brazil, Canada, China, France, Germany, Greece, India, Italy, Japan and Mexico. Other themed locations add creative dishes that are not tied to one country.

Celebrating the Festival’s 30th Anniversary

The food and wine festival 2026 epcot event celebrates three decades of food-focused entertainment. The festival began in 1996 and has developed into one of EPCOT’s best-known seasonal events. Disney is marking the anniversary with 30 returning or reimagined menu items from past festivals. These dishes give longtime visitors a taste of festival history while introducing newer guests to old favorites.

Special merchandise also supports the anniversary celebration. Visitors can find festival-themed clothing, pins, kitchen products, souvenirs, and other limited seasonal items while supplies last.

Eat to the Beat Concert Series

Food is only part of the experience. The Eat to the Beat Concert Series brings live music to America Gardens Theatre and runs nightly from August 27 through November 16.

Concerts normally begin at 5:30 PM, 6:45 PM, and 8:00 PM. Standard concert viewing is included with valid EPCOT admission, but seating is available on a first-come, first-served basis.

Eat to the Beat Dining Packages

Visitors who want guaranteed concert seating can consider an Eat to the Beat Concert Series Dining Package. The package combines a meal at a participating EPCOT restaurant with reserved-section access to a concert that day.

This option can be helpful when a popular performer appears. Regular concert admission remains included with valid EPCOT admission, but ordinary seating is not guaranteed.

Remy’s Ratatouille Hide & Squeak

Families can explore EPCOT through Remy’s Ratatouille Hide & Squeak. The scavenger hunt asks guests to search around the park for Remy figures hidden in different locations. Participants use stickers to mark their discoveries on a special map. After the activity, they can present the map at a participating location to receive a festival keepsake.

The activity costs extra and is not part of standard admission. However, guests do not need to complete every part of the hunt to claim the available keepsake.

Food and Drinks for Different Tastes

The food and wine festival 2026 epcot experience is not designed only for wine drinkers. Marketplaces sell many non-alcoholic drinks, desserts, snacks, meat dishes, seafood, and plant-based selections.

This range makes the event suitable for families and visitors with different tastes. Disney also provides information about allergy-friendly choices, although guests with food allergies should confirm ingredients before ordering. Alcoholic drinks are available for eligible adults at many locations. Guests should bring proper identification and follow Walt Disney World rules for alcohol purchases.

Festival Passport and Planning Your Food Tour

One of the simplest planning tools is the Festival Passport. Guests can pick one up at EPCOT and use it to review marketplace menus, activities, entertainment, and festival information.

Instead of buying everything that looks interesting, visitors can mark their favorite dishes first. Sharing several small dishes with family or friends can also make it easier to experience more flavors. Starting early may help guests avoid some of the busiest food lines. Weekends and evenings can attract larger crowds, especially when well-known artists perform.

Best Time to Visit the Festival

The ideal visit depends on what a guest wants to experience. Visitors focused on food may prefer weekdays, while music fans may choose dates based on the Eat to the Beat performer schedule. Some experiences begin after the main festival starts. Checking marketplace opening dates is important if a specific booth or anniversary activity is a major reason for the trip.

Florida can also remain hot during the early part of the festival. Comfortable clothes, water, sunscreen, and breaks inside air-conditioned attractions can make a long tasting day easier.
